RE: The tariff classification of bath puppets from China.

Dear Mr. Maras:

In your letter of July 29, 1999, you requested a tariff classification ruling on behalf of Rody & Company Marketing Inc.

The merchandise is identified as Bath Time Puppets and is hand mitts in the form of highly stylistic representations of animal characters. The articles are described as intended to amuse children during bath time. You neglect to mention that they are also designed and eminently suitable for the functional use as a hand wash mitt. The character mitts are approximately nine inches in height and eight inches at their widest point. Sewn on three sides, there is an opening on the fourth side of the mitt for the insertion of a hand. The articles are composed of 39% by weight of cotton terry, 35% Polyester fill and lining and 26% natural sisal.

The principle use of these character bath puppets will be as a plaything or as a source of amusement. The applicable subheading for the merchandise will be 9503.49.0025, Harmonized Tariff Schedule of the United States (HTSUS), which provides for toys representing animals or non-human creatures, other than stuffed. The duty rate will be free.

This ruling is being issued under the provisions of Part 177 of the Customs Regulations (19 C.F.R. 177).
